Has anyone heard regarding the bat requirements? I do see that Dizzy Dean is going with a -3 on age groups of 13 and above. Just wondering if other organizations are doing the same? At 13 and demanding a minus 3 as opposed to minus 5 is a little crazy. These kids will be going from a -10 to a -3 in one year (age 12 to age 13)
